Nestled in the heart of Halali, Nuamses Waterhole is a breathtaking natural oasis where visitors can witness the majestic wildlife of Namibia up close. This serene spot is particularly renowned for its elephant sightings, offering a unique opportunity to observe these gentle giants in their natural habitat. Ideal for photographers and nature enthusiasts alike, Nuamses Waterhole promises an unforgettable experience amidst the stunning landscapes of Namibia.
